    I would avoid Spanish. French or German is a much better choice. Just because illegal immigrants are crossing the border does not mean Spanish will help you. France and Germany are two of the largest economies in the world.

    Nation ------- GDP ---------- per capita
    ----------------------------------------
    Mexico ------ 0.693 trillion ----- $10,000
    France ------ 2.055 trillion ----- $29,600
    Germany ---- 2.730 trillion ----- $30,100
    Italy -------- 1.710 trillion ----- $28,700
    Japan ------- 4.664 trillion ----- $31,600
    USA -------- 12.490 trillion ---- $41,600

    Here is a good list of reasons to learn French - http://www.ecu.edu.au/ses/iccs/cware/french/motivation/whyfren.htm

    I would also consider how much fun a language is. France and Italy offer lots of high end goods- fashion, food, films. Germany and France are known as a centers of science in Europe.

    If you look at just the $$$ above, you might be tempted to study Japanese. But I believe you could learn both French and German in the time it would take to learn Japanese. Unless you want to work for Sony or Toyota, I would pick a European language.
